From Grassroots to Elite Sports: Social Video Learning
As the largest national sports association in the world, the German Football Association (DFB) plays a pivotal role in coach education—both at the grassroots level and in A-level elite sports. To ensure professionalism across all tiers, the DFB consistently adheres to the highest quality standards in qualification and advanced training.
The Challenge: Scaling Quality, Ensuring Practical Application
To combine first-class qualification with digital innovation, the DFB has partnered with Ghostthinker since 2016, driving a strategic collaboration to redefine modern coach education.
Main challenges to be addressed:
- Practical Transfer: How can we ensure that theoretical knowledge is effectively applied on the football pitch in the long term?
- Interaction & Reflection: How can coaches learn from one another and deeply reflect on their own practice within a digital setting?
- Technological Gap: Traditional software solutions lacked the specific pedagogical and didactical tailoring required for sports education.
- Scalability: How can high-quality coach education be delivered efficiently and on a nationwide scale to a highly diverse target group—from grassroots volunteers to elite professionals?
Our Shared Journey: Shaping the Future of Sports Education
Ghostthinker delivers more than just software—we deliver the future of learning. Since 2016, our sports science expertise and technological innovation have merged into a unique techno-didactical concept, tailor-made for the DFB’s educational ecosystem.
- Strategic Consulting: Joint analysis of educational goals to design a sustainable, tailored pedagogical concept.
- Co-Creation: Development of customized learning experiences based on Ghostthinker’s innovative “Social Video Learning” method, seamlessly aligned with the DFB competency model.
- Implementation & Support: Phased rollout of edubreak®CAMPUS for coach education and continuous professional development (CPD) across all license levels and pre-qualification courses. We provide full instructional design and technical implementation support for all user groups.
- Since 2025, the expansion has also been underway for the training courses and development programs of all 55,000 amateur referees.
- In addition to our formal learning platform, the edubreak®COMMUNITY was also introduced as a space for networking and exchange.
